Output 8938101d3362598626cf7e2cf6929ccc8e81e6e149db351b36d442ed0d3c64e6:1

value
561510400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eea99f7c2091a8903b195f417c33bf9f940a8642 OP_EQUAL
address
3PSwwp18apCHYwZJ3w5hnf4htAC5JbqdAp
transaction
8938101d3362598626cf7e2cf6929ccc8e81e6e149db351b36d442ed0d3c64e6
confirmations
467400
spent
true